Output 57d2a77d0bf83de81f81dcb29167c5b64b17cd20ef8365f752855dc6dd09dd6c:0

value
301855939
script pubkey
OP_0 OP_PUSHBYTES_20 80ccc2627e68e66e3b96aae546db9f273307c7d9
address
ltc1qsrxvycn7drnxuwuk4tj5dkulyues037ezur0np
transaction
57d2a77d0bf83de81f81dcb29167c5b64b17cd20ef8365f752855dc6dd09dd6c
spent
true